Had a wild phileo sandwich — chicken based on a hoagie — it was great. Chicken was properly cooked (a rarity) which left it moist and flavorful. Bun was equally moist and great. Seasoning had a little spice, a nice surprise for small town Minnesota. Wet cappuccino was good. My partner had a veggie sandwich which she enjoyed. Restaurant is in a huge space, tastefully decorated and set up as a music venue. Could be fun.
Recommendation to owner. Offer the salads without meat and price meat as an add on. The all meat on almost every menu item annoyed my vegetarian partner.

I chose Phileo's from their previous Google reviews because my sister and I were were coming into Worthington from opposite directions and neither of us was familiar with the town. Phileo's was definitely the right choice! Very easy access from the Highway and the Interstate both. Warm and comfortable atmosphere, and a menu that took us by surprise. Phileo's isn't just a "sit down and eat kind of place," it's also a "relax in an easy chair or sofa and enjoy the moment" kind of place. Anticipating just an OK experience, we thoroughly enjoyed the large variety of menu selections. I highly recommend the Gyan - grilled chicken, craisins, bacon and parmesan cheese on a croissant because it was delicious and served warm. Neither of us ordered from the coffee menu, but it looked excellent. Lots of Lattes, frappes, and other treats. Next time I'm in Worthington, I won't have to go online to search for a place to stop - I already know it'll be Phileo's!
